a.mediaMainNavA {
    display: block;
    width: 140px;
    height: 27px;
    color: #DDD;
    border: 0;
    padding-top: 7px;
    padding-left: 20px;
    text-decoration: none;
    background: #20355B url(../img/navMainDef.jpg) top left no-repeat;
}

a.mediaMainNavA:hover {
    background-color: #20355B;
    color: #FFF;
}

a.mediaMainNavN {
    display: block;
    width: 140px;
    height: 27px;
    color: #FFF;
    border: 0;
    padding-top: 7px;
    padding-left: 20px;
    text-decoration: none;
    background: #000 url(../img/navMainPas.jpg) top left no-repeat;
}

a.mediaMainNavN:hover {
    color: #DDD;
    background: #20355B url(../img/navMainDef.jpg) top left no-repeat;
}

div.mediaMainNavABox{
    width: 150px;
    background: #17515D url(../img/navMainLink.jpg) top left no-repeat;
}

div.mediaSubNavBox {
    padding-left: 20px;
    padding-right: 10px;
    padding-top: 5px;
    width: 120px;
    background: #17515D url(../img/navMainLinkB.jpg) top left repeat;
}

div.mediaSubNavBox2 {
    border-top: 1px solid #000;
    border-left: 1px solid #000;
    border-right: 1px solid #FFF;
    border-bottom: 1px solid #FFF;
    background-color: #D1E6EE;
    padding: 2px 2px 1px 2px;
    margin: 0;
}

div.mediaNavBoxFoot{
    padding-left: 20px;
    padding-right: 10px;
    padding-top: 5px;
    width: 120px;
    height: 8px;
    background: #17515D url(../img/navMainLink.jpg) bottom left repeat;
}
a.mediaSubNavA {
    display: block;
    color: #000;
    text-decoration: none;
    background-color: #B2D4DF;
    padding: 0 0 0 5px;
    margin: 0 0 1px 0;
}
a.mediaSubNavA:hover {
    background-color: #B2D4DF;
}

a.mediaSubNavP {
    display: block;
    color: #000;
    text-decoration: none;
    background-color: #D1E6EE;
    padding: 0 0 0 5px;
    margin: 0 0 1px 0;
}
a.mediaSubNavP:hover {
    background-color: #B2D4DF;
}

a.mediaSubNavP {
    display: block;
    color: #000;
    text-decoration: none;
}
a.mediaSubNavP:hover {
}

.MediaContentOV {
    position: relative;
    top: 0;
    background-color: #FFF;
    width: 530px;
    float: left;
}

.MediaRightBox {
    background-color: #FFF;
    font-size: 9px;
    padding-left: 10px;
    border-left: 1px dashed #CCC;
    margin: 0;
    width: 290px;
    position: relative;
    top: 0;
    margin-left: 530px;
}

.MediaContent {
    position: relative;
    top: 0;
    background-color: #FFF;
    width: 530px;
    float: left;
}

.MediaMainBox {
    margin-bottom: 10px;
    background-color: #DDD;
    padding: 10px;
    margin: 0 3px 10px 3px;
}

.MediaDetails {
    background-color: #FFF;
    font-size: 9px;
    padding: 0;
    padding-left: 10px;
    border-left: 1px dashed #CCC;
    margin: 0;
    width: 290px;
    position: relative;
    top: 0;
    margin-left: 529px;
    background: #EEE url(../img/bg_rb.gif) top left repeat-y;
}

.MediaItemDeatilBox {
    padding: 10px;
    background-color: #DDD;
}

.MediaItemDeatilBox > h1 {
    font-size: 12px;
    font-weight: bold;
    margin: 0 0 2px 0;
    padding: 5px 10px 5px 10px;
    background-color: #555;
    color: #FFF;
}

div.MediaArtistBox {
    width: 110px;
    height: 110px;
    padding-left: 10px;
    float: right;
}

.MediaItemDeatilBox > p {
    font-size: 10px;
    margin: 0;
    padding: 10px;
    background-color: #FFF;
    color: #000;
    height: 90px;
}


.MediaBox > h1 {
    font-size: 12px;
    margin: 0;
    padding: 0;
    background-color: #555;
    color: #FFF;
}

.MediaBox {
    float: left;
    border: 4px solid #DDD;
    height: 150px;
    width: 160px;
    background-color: #AAA;
    position: relative;
    margin: auto;
}

.MediaBox:hover {
    border: 4px solid #333;
}

.MediaBoxDescr{
    font-size: 10px;
    padding-left: 10px;
    color: #FFF;
    position: absolute;
    top: 0;
    background-color: #333;
    width: 150px;
}

.MediaBox > h3 {
    font-size: 10px;
    margin: 0;
    padding: 5px;
    position: absolute;
    top: 100px;
    background-color: #555;
    width: 150px;
    height: 40px;
}

a.MediaBoxLink {
    color: #FFF;
    text-decoration: none;
}

a.MediaBoxLink:hover {
    color: #DDD;
    text-decoration: underline;
}

.MediaOvBody {
}

.mediaOvItem {
    color: #000;
    background-color: #DDD;
    width: 255px;
    float: left;
    margin: 5px;
}

.mediaOvItem:hover {
    background-color: #FFF;
}
.mediaOvItem > h1 {
    font-weight: bold;
    background-color: #AAA;
    color: #EEE;
    font-size: 12px;
    padding: 4px;
    margin: 0;
    height: 25px;
}
.mediaOvItem > p {
    padding: 5px;
    margin: 0;
    font-size: 10px;
}
